Bayern Kapital

Bayern Kapital is a venture capital investor based in Landshut, Bavaria, Germany, focusing on high-tech and deep-tech startups. It supports companies from pre-seed to exit, managing approximately €700 million in assets.

Bayern Kapital as a funder

Investment thesis

Bayern Kapital focuses on investing in high-tech startups and scale-ups in Bavaria, emphasizing sustainable innovation and long-term success. The fund supports companies from pre-seed through growth stages, leveraging its government-backed structure to act as an anchor investor.

Focus narrative

Bayern Kapital invests in innovative high-tech, deep-tech, and life sciences startups and scale-ups located in Bavaria. The organization provides funding ranging from 250,000 euros to 50 million euros, supporting companies from the pre-seed stage through growth and scale-up phases to exit. Its investment strategy emphasizes sustainable innovation and long-term success rather than quick returns.

Value beyond capital

Bayern Kapital adds value to its portfolio companies through long-term partnerships, providing not only capital but also strategic support and access to a network of resources within Bavaria. The fund's government-backed structure allows it to act as an anchor investor, facilitating additional co-investment opportunities.

Portfolio context

Bayern Kapital's portfolio includes notable companies such as: commercetools: Provides digital commerce solutions for global brands. DeepDrive: Develops high-efficiency electric motors for the automotive industry. EGYM: Offers a flexible ecosystem for the fitness industry. Isar Aerospace: Designs and builds launch vehicles for cost-effective satellite transport. OroraTech: Specializes in thermal-infrared analysis using space-based sensors. Proxima Fusion: A spin-out from the Max Planck Institute focused on energy sector innovations. SimScale: A cloud-based engineering simulation platform. SIRION: Develops AAV-based vectors for gene therapy.
